Porch floor repair services involve assessing and restoring the structural integrity and appearance of a porch’s surface. Over time, exposure to weather elements such as rain, snow, and sunlight can cause wood or concrete porch floors to deteriorate. Local contractors can identify issues like rotting wood, cracked or crumbling concrete, loose boards, or uneven surfaces. Repair work may include replacing damaged sections, reinforcing the underlying structure, or applying protective coatings to extend the life of the porch. These services help homeowners maintain a safe, attractive entryway that enhances curb appeal and provides a sturdy space for outdoor activities.
Many problems can signal the need for porch floor repair, including visible cracks, sagging, or wobbling boards. Water damage is a common culprit that leads to rotting wood or weakening of the underlying supports. Warped or buckled flooring can create tripping hazards, while loose or missing nails and screws may compromise stability. If the porch surface feels uneven or shows signs of significant wear, it’s a clear indication that repairs are needed.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ent further damage, avoid costly replacements, and ensure the porch remains a functional and welcoming part of the home.

The overview below groups typical Porch Floor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Saint Peters, MO.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or porch floor repairs, such as replacing a few damaged boards or patching small cracks,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ed.
Moderate Repairs - For more extensive patching or partial replacement of porch flooring, local contractors often charge between $600-$1,500. Larger, more complex projects can reach higher costs but are less common in this category.
Full Replacement - Replacing an entire porch floor can vary widely, with typical costs from $2,000-$5,000 depending on size, materials, and additional work like framing or leveling. Many projects in this range involve standard-sized porches with common materials.
Custom or Large-Scale Projects - Larger or custom porch flooring projects, such as extensive rebuilds or specialty materials, can exceed $5,000. These tend to be less frequent but are handled by local pros for more complex or high-end installations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
